Summary
Schilder's diffuse myelinoclastic sclerosis, a rare childhood disease, presented in a 6-year-old girl with cerebral lesions. Despite spontaneous improvement, neuropsychological development arrested, highlighting diagnostic and prognostic challenges.

Background:
- Schilder's diffuse myelinoclastic sclerosis is a rare demyelinating disease affecting children.
- Early diagnosis and understanding of its natural history are crucial for management.
Observation:
- A 6-year-old girl presented with subacute cerebral disease and asymmetric, rim-enhancing white matter lesions on CT.
- Spontaneous clinical improvement preceded corticosteroid therapy.
Findings:
- Follow-up CT and MRI over three years revealed stable amyelinic lesions.
- Motor function and electrophysiological recordings improved, but neuropsychological development showed an arrest.
- The case highlights the varied clinical course and imaging findings in childhood Schilder's disease.
